Boston’s Kenmore Square: Fenway Park, Boston University, and Fine Art
If you’ve ever watched the Red Sox play at Fenway Park on TV, your eye may have been drawn to a vintage Citgo gasoline sign looming in the background behind left field’s “Green Monster” wall. Follow the sign’s luminous face to where it overlooks the intersection of Beacon Street and Commonwealth Avenue, and you’ll find yourself in Kenmore Square.
Situated just west of the Back Bay neighborhood and Boston Common, Kenmore Square is best known as the home of Fenway Park and Boston University, the latter of which has been a fixture in this part of town since it was established in 1839. Take a stroll along Commonwealth Avenue for a picturesque tour of the campus.
On the south side of the ballpark, past the Fenway Victory Gardens and the Back Bay Fens, is the Museum of Fine Arts. Among the largest museums in the United States, the MFA contains about 450,000 works of art. Prominent works include Gilbert Stuart’s 1796 portrait of George Washington and a priceless collection of works by Monet and Cézanne. Adjacent to the MFA, the Isabella Stewart Gardner Museum boasts its own impressive collection of world art.
